SKY BLUES FURY AT PITCH FARCE

Millers game postponed
By John Lyons

PITCHING IN: Fiji score in the Rugby Sevens at the Coventry Building Society Arena

FUMING Coventry City say they were ‘extremely disappointed’ to have to postpone today’s match against Rotherham United.
Following an inspection by a senior match official yesterday, the pitch at the Coventry Building Society Arena was deemed unsafe and unplayable.
It followed an inspection that took place on Friday by the EFL and a local referee, which was also attended by Sky Blues manager Mark Robins and chief executive Dave Boddy.
